递归经典面试题_ 小例
2023-09-14 09:00:21 时间
主要内容如下:
1 private void button1_Click(object sender, EventArgs e) 2 { 3 //按钮事件 4 int value; 5 if(int.TryParse(textBox1.Text,out value)){ 6 label2.Text= function(value).ToString(); 7 }else{ 8 MessageBox.Show("请输入正确的数","提示:"); 9 } 10 11 } 12 //定义递归计算的方法 13 int function(int args) 14 { 15 if(args==0){ 16 return 0; 17 }else if(args>=1&&args<=2){ 18 return 1; 19 }else{ 20 return function(args - 1) + function(args - 2); 21 } 22 }
实现结果:
相关文章
- mysql经典面试题及答案_常见的SQL面试题
- 运维必须掌握的27道Linux面试题
- 测试常见面试题之场景测试回答策略(如电梯该怎么测等)
- 《面试季》经典面试题(六)
- 《面试季》经典面试题-数据库篇(三)
- 前端一面经典react面试题(边面边更)
- 经典面试题 HTTPS和HTTP有什么区别?[通俗易懂]
- Spark常见20个面试题(含大部分答案)
- js异步编程面试题你能答上来几道
- 前端高频手写面试题
- react面试题笔记整理
- Java集合面试题_java是什么
- 数据结构面试经典问题汇总及答案_数据结构基础面试题
- 前端二面经典面试题指南_2023-02-28
- 美团前端二面面试题_2023-02-28
- 前端经典面试题(有答案)_2023-02-28
- 校招前端二面经典面试题(附答案)_2023-03-02
- Go 常见算法面试题篇(三):高效调整数组数值顺序
- 【C语言经典面试题】这样的char * 定义怎么回事
- Linux经典面试题
- 校招前端经典react面试题(附答案)
- React常见面试题
- 校招前端二面经典react面试题及答案_2023-03-13
- Redis分布式锁的实现方式(redis面试题)
- python3 开发面试题(collections中的Counter)6.7详解编程语言
- 阿里历年经典Java面试题汇总,想进BAT你还不快收藏!详解编程语言
- 大智慧(互联网金融领域 )运维岗位面试题
- Linux面试题解析与实例:学习Linux面试必备技能(linux笔试面试题)
- Redis负载均衡面试指南(redis负载均衡面试题)